Cracks in your home’s foundation are typically caused by drying shrinkage, or thermal movement, and can cause minor problems that can expand if not corrected. Minor cracks over time can grow larger and cause a loss of structural integrity or more commonly, water leakage into the home.

Reduce Mold & Radon
Most basements eventually leak sometime in their lifetimes. Even if a crack is not leaking now, eventually water will find it and any environment that has water (moisture) will contribute to the growth of mold via that leak. The mold will continue to grow if a moisture problem remains undiscovered or unaddressed, worsening conditions such as asthma, hay fever, and or other allergies. The best and most cost effective strategy to managing the growth of mold and mildew is to prevent the intrusion of water and moisture into the basement. Any home may have a radon problem.
Minimize the entry of cancer causing radon gas and moisture, that effects mold growth, into your home by sealing cracks in the foundation and along the basement walls.
